1. Discover the Breathtaking Beaches of South Africa
Does South Africa offer stunning beaches? Absolutely, South Africa boasts some of the most beautiful and diverse beaches in the world. From the trendy shores of Camps Bay in Cape Town, known for its vibrant atmosphere and stunning views, to the unique Boulders Beach, home to a colony of African penguins, there’s a beach for every taste.
Camps Bay beach with Table Mountain backdrop
Along the Garden Route and the KwaZulu-Natal coastline, you’ll find pristine sandy stretches perfect for relaxation and water sports. These beaches offer warm waters, ideal for swimming and diving, enhancing the allure of South African coastal tourism. 2. Experience the Best Big 5 Sightings in Africa
Where can you find the Big 5 in South Africa? South Africa is one of the premier destinations for witnessing the Big Five: lion, leopard, elephant, rhino, and buffalo. Kruger National Park, along with its private reserves like Sabi Sands, is renowned for its exceptional wildlife viewing opportunities.
Leopard lounging in Sabi Sands
These reserves provide exclusive and intimate safari experiences, making it easier to spot these majestic creatures in their natural habitat. Other notable locations include Madikwe Game Reserve, Phinda Game Reserve, Pilanesberg National Park, and Addo Elephant National Park, each offering unique wildlife encounters and contributing to South Africa’s reputation as a top safari destination.
3. Indulge in Superb Food & Wine Experiences
Is South Africa a culinary destination? Yes, South Africa is a haven for food and wine enthusiasts, offering a rich tapestry of flavors and culinary experiences. Cape Town and the Cape Winelands are at the heart of this gastronomic adventure.
Wine tasting in Cape Winelands
Here, you can explore picturesque estates, sample award-winning wines, and savor world-class cuisine. Johannesburg is rapidly becoming a foodie hub, with craft beer, vibrant markets, and innovative restaurants that blend local and international flavors. The KwaZulu-Natal Midlands also offer a gourmet escape amidst rolling hills. 4. Engage in Activities in Abundance
What kind of activities can you do in South Africa? South Africa is an adventure playground, offering a wide array of activities to suit every interest. You can hike Table Mountain, go whale watching in Hermanus, or take a guided walking tour of Johannesburg to immerse yourself in the country’s urban culture.
Cable car to the top of Table Mountain
For outdoor enthusiasts, there’s horse riding in the Drakensberg, paragliding over Cape Town’s beaches, and cycling through the Cape Winelands. Golfers can enjoy world-class courses, and nature lovers can explore the forest canopy in the Garden Route. The abundance of sunshine, mountains, sea, and rivers ensures there’s never a dull moment in South Africa.

6. Enjoy Near-Perfect Weather Year-Round
What is the climate like in South Africa? South Africa boasts a temperate climate with plenty of sunshine, making it an ideal destination year-round. Durban and the KwaZulu-Natal Coast average over 300 sunny days a year.
Luxury treehouse accommodation in Kruger
Even during the rainy season in Kruger, the rainfall typically consists of short afternoon showers, leaving the air fresh and the skies clear for stunning photographs. The pleasant weather is a major draw for travelers, ensuring a memorable vacation experience. Depending on your interests, the best time to visit varies: May to October is ideal for safaris, November to March for Cape Town beaches, and July to November for whale watching.
7. Plan a Family-Friendly Adventure
Is South Africa a good destination for families? Absolutely, South Africa is a fantastic destination for family holidays, offering a wide range of child-friendly accommodations and activities. Cape Town and the Garden Route are particularly popular for beach breaks, while reserves like Pilanesberg and Madikwe offer malaria-free safari experiences.
Family enjoying a game drive in Madikwe
Many lodges offer junior ranger programs, shorter game drives, and educational games to keep children engaged. Sun City, a resort with a sandy beach and ocean in the middle of the bush, is another great option for family fun.
8. Immerse Yourself in Rich History
What historical sites can you visit in South Africa? South Africa is steeped in history, offering a plethora of sites to explore. The Cradle of Humankind is a must-visit, where you can see the 2.3-million-year-old fossil, Mrs Ples.
Nelson Mandela Capture Site memorial
For more recent history, the KwaZulu-Natal Battlefields offer insights into the Anglo-Zulu War, while Robben Island, where Nelson Mandela was imprisoned, provides a poignant reminder of the country’s struggle for freedom. Cape Town, the oldest city, and the Constantia Winelands, dating back over 300 years, offer a glimpse into South Africa’s colonial past.

FAQ About Tourism in South Africa
1. What is the best time to visit South Africa?
The best time to visit South Africa depends on your interests. For wildlife safaris, May to October is ideal. For beach holidays in Cape Town, November to March is recommended, and for whale watching, July to November is best.
2. Is South Africa safe for tourists?
While South Africa has safety concerns, taking precautions and being aware of your surroundings can ensure a safe trip. Avoid walking alone at night, keep valuables out of sight, and use reputable transportation services.
3. What are the must-see attractions in South Africa?
Must-see attractions include Kruger National Park, Table Mountain, Robben Island, the Garden Route, and the Cape Winelands.
4. Do I need a visa to visit South Africa?
Visa requirements depend on your nationality. Check the South African embassy or consulate in your country for the latest visa information.
5. What languages are spoken in South Africa?
South Africa has 11 official languages, including English, Afrikaans, Zulu, and Xhosa.
6. What currency is used in South Africa?
The South African currency is the Rand (ZAR).
7. How can I get around South Africa?
You can get around South Africa by renting a car, using taxis or ride-sharing services, or taking domestic flights.
8. What should I pack for a trip to South Africa?
Pack comfortable clothing, sunscreen, insect repellent, a hat, sunglasses, and a camera. If you’re planning a safari, bring neutral-colored clothing and sturdy shoes.
9. What are some popular souvenirs to buy in South Africa?
Popular souvenirs include handcrafted items, such as beadwork, wood carvings, and textiles, as well as local wines and spices.
10. How far in advance should I book my trip to South Africa?
It’s best to book your trip to South Africa well in advance, especially if you’re traveling during peak season. This will ensure you get the best deals on flights, accommodations, and tours.
